Key Responsibilities: Plan, supervise, and coordinate the daily operations of the dietary department.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local regulations, including sanitation, safety, and health standards. Develop menus that meet nutritional guidelines, dietary restrictions, and resident/patient preferences. Manage inventory, order supplies, and control food costs while minimizing waste. Recruit, train, and supervise dietary staff, including cooks and dietary aides. Collaborate with healthcare staff to meet special dietary needs of residents/patients. Maintain accurate records of menus, production reports, and regulatory documentation. Monitor and enforce proper food handling, storage, and sanitation practices. Foster a positive, safe, and efficient work environment. Qualifications: Must possess, as a minimum, a high school diploma or its equivalent. Certified Dietary Manager (CDM) or Certified Food Protection Professional (CFPP) credential required. Must have ServSafe Certification One-year experience in a long-term care facility dietary department preferred Strong leadership, communication, and organizational skills Must maintain all required continuing education/licensing.
